引言
在当今互联网时代,网络隐私和安全已成为每个用户关注的焦点。v2ray作为一种先进的网络代理工具,以其灵活性和强大的功能受到了广泛的欢迎。本文将深入探讨v2ray核心API的使用和配置,帮助用户更好地理解和应用这一工具。
什么是v2ray?
v2ray是一种开放源代码的网络代理工具,专注于科学上网。它的设计初衷是提供更高效、更安全的上网体验。通过使用v2ray核心API,开发者和用户能够实现定制化的网络请求,增强网络安全性和隐私性。
v2ray核心API的主要功能
1. 代理协议支持
v2ray支持多种代理协议,包括但不限于:
- VMess
- VLESS
- Shadowsocks
- SOCKS
- HTTP
这些协议使得v2ray在不同的网络环境下具有极强的适应性。
2. 高度可配置性
v2ray核心API提供丰富的配置选项,用户可以根据自己的需求进行定制,包括:
- 路由选择
- 流量控制
- 混淆设置
3. 数据加密
为了保护用户的隐私,v2ray提供强大的数据加密机制,确保用户在使用过程中数据不被泄露。
4. 支持多用户模式
v2ray核心API允许在同一服务器上支持多个用户进行独立连接,增强了资源的利用率。
v2ray核心API的使用
1. 安装v2ray
在使用v2ray核心API之前,首先需要安装v2ray。可以通过以下步骤进行安装:
- 访问v2ray官方GitHub
- 下载对应系统的安装包
- 按照说明文档进行安装
2. 配置v2ray
安装完成后,用户需要对v2ray核心API进行配置。以下是基本的配置步骤:
- 打开配置文件
config.json
,进行编辑 - 设置基本的网络参数,包括地址、端口等
- 配置用户信息和代理协议
3. 启动v2ray
完成配置后,可以通过命令行启动v2ray服务。运行以下命令: bash v2ray run
4. 验证连接
在启动服务后,用户可以使用curl命令或者浏览器测试网络连接是否正常。
v2ray核心API的应用场景
1. 科学上网
v2ray主要用于科学上网,帮助用户访问被封锁的网站和服务。
2. 保护隐私
通过数据加密和隐蔽连接,v2ray有效保护用户的上网隐私。
3. 企业网络
在企业环境中,v2ray可用于远程办公和数据传输,提高网络安全性。
常见问题解答(FAQ)
1. v2ray和其他代理工具有什么区别?
v2ray相较于其他代理工具如Shadowsocks,具有更高的可定制性和安全性。v2ray支持多种协议,能够在不同网络环境下灵活应用。
2. 如何解决v2ray连接不稳定的问题?
- 检查网络环境,确保网络连接稳定。
- 调整v2ray配置,尝试更换不同的代理协议。
- 更新v2ray至最新版本,以获取更好的稳定性和安全性。
3. v2ray是否可以在手机上使用?
是的,v2ray支持多平台使用,包括Android和iOS。用户可以下载相应的客户端进行配置和使用。
4. 如何确保v2ray的安全性?
- 使用强密码保护用户信息。
- 定期更新v2ray,确保使用最新的安全补丁。
- 配置加密连接,保护数据传输的安全。
总结
v2ray核心API作为一个强大的网络代理工具,凭借其灵活的配置和强大的功能,成为了用户保护隐私和实现科学上网的优选方案。希望通过本文的介绍,能够帮助用户更深入地了解和使用v2ray核心API。